Ancient musicians employed many scales and modes to produce special sound textures. The Greeks, one example is, made use of the tetrachord, which divides an octave into four notes. They crafted scales on these tetrachords to craft melodies which were equally intricate and emotive.

“These lyres, relationship from 2500 BC had been found in the tombs with the royal spouse and children of Ur,” says Nele Ziegler, a historian specializing in Mesopotamia and co-curator of the exhibition.3 “We've been really privileged that these devices, decorated with gold and cherished stones, have survived, given that the wood they were being made from experienced totally decomposed. Yet Woolley's ingenious strategy of constructing plaster casts on the vacant spaces it experienced still left allows us to admire them today.”

” The supreme exam of musical skill, thought of probably the most hard, was that of cithara accompanied by singing. “Emperor Nero, who fancied himself as a specialist musician, sought glory to be a competitor,” Vincent says. “He made a triumphant tour of Greece in 64-65 AD and—to no person’s shock—gained the many acclaims!”

“Musical scores in the shape of tablature happen to be discovered from as far back as 1800 BC, together with texts specifying the title of each and every string as well as the tuning of the instruments.” As for enjoying the melodies of ancient Mesopotamia right now, “The top we will offer is undoubtedly an interpretation,” Ziegler admits. “We know the names from the notes along with the intervals in between them, but not what pitch Every Notice corresponds to. Can it be an E? An A?”

In Egypt and Mesopotamia they ended up thought of mere ancient civilizations craftsmen whose only benefit lay while in the service that they delivered, although in ancient Greece and Rome some musicians were being genuinely celebrated for their talent. “There was an ongoing Opposition One of the Greek cities, with contests for musicians who performed the aulos (a type of double oboe) or maybe the cithara, as well as winners attained genuine superstar,” Perrot recounts

By the way, stringed devices were being usually performed With all the fingers or maybe a plectrum as an alternative to that has a bow and from the Classical Time period, stringed devices have been favoured over wind because they authorized the participant to also sing and, for that Greeks, text had been viewed as more critical than musical Appears.
